Fabian Coulthard made the best of wet conditions to top the morning warm-up at the Wilson Security Sandown 500.

A wet track greeted the drivers for the start of the warm-up, with drizzle prevailing throughout the 20 minutes.

Times started in the 1:25s before steadily improving. Coulthard’s 1:18.47s best proved 0.7s quicker than second quickest man Matt Campbell.

The performance proved a boost for Coulthard after a frustrating Saturday that sees the #66 DJR Team Penske Ford starting 11th.

“It was relatively easy, I was really happy with the car,” smiled Coulthard.

“It’s surprising because we haven’t driven this car a hell of a lot in the rain.

“If we’ve got a car like that and it rains all day I think we’re in with a shot.

“I just want the weather to be consistent throughout the day so that the race doesn’t become a lottery.”

Rookie Campbell was the star of the session in the #7 Nissan Altima, proving among the pace-setters before handing over to primary driver Todd Kelly.

“Matt hadn’t done any driving in the wet before so we thought we’d leave him in for the whole session,” explained Kelly, who had a late off at Turn 11.

“It wasn’t too long and he was the fastest out there so we thought we’d put me in the car to get a few laps.

“It looks like it might dry out but we’re hoping for rain because we’ve got a good wet car.”

The Scott McLaughlin/David Wall GRM Volvo, David Reynolds/Craig Baird Erebus Holden and Scott Pye/Tony D’Alberto Penske Ford completed the top five.

The warm-up ran green throughout despite several tasting the grass.

Among them was noted wet weather master Shane van Gisbergen, who ran off at Turn 11 before later engaging in a side-to-side duel with compatriot Richie Stanaway on the front straight.

The 161 lap Wilson Security Sandown 500 will get underway at 1315 local time.
